How they compare

Brazil currently reports 37.7% against 33.5% in Bulgaria, a difference of 4.2%.

That makes Brazil's figure about 1.1 times Bulgaria's.

The two have swapped places 6 times across 61 shared years of data; in 1965 it was Brazil ahead.

Brazil ranks 9th and Bulgaria ranks 12th of 79 countries.

Brazil has averaged higher in every one of the 7 decades both report.

Head to head by decade

Decade Brazil Bulgaria Difference Ahead
1960s 11.0% 1.3% 9.7% Brazil
1970s 12.5% 3.8% 8.7% Brazil
1980s 22.2% 11.5% 10.7% Brazil
1990s 25.5% 19.0% 6.4% Brazil
2000s 25.7% 25.2% 0.4% Brazil
2010s 29.0% 26.9% 2.1% Brazil
2020s 35.4% 32.4% 3.1% Brazil

Averages of every year both report within each decade.
